O cliente OwnCloud não pode sincronizar porque “… O certificado do servidor estava faltando o atributo commonName no nome do assunto”

0

Eu instalei o OwnCloud 7 no meu servidor Ubuntu. O servidor é autoassinado com SSL. Ao acessá-lo no navegador eu recebo as seguintes 2 mensagens:

The security certificate presented by this website was not issued by a trusted certificate authority. The security certificate presented by this website was issued for a different website's address.

Mas depois clico em Continuar para este site e tudo funciona bem.

Agora quero usar o cliente do Windows. Eu posso conectar ao servidor, mas não consigo sincronizar. Apenas mostra a seguinte mensagem de erro:

"... Server certificate was missing commonName attribute in subject name"

Gerei um novo arquivo de chave, certifiquei-me de que o commonName esteja preenchido e configurei o apache2 para usar este arquivo de chave, mas ainda recebo o mesmo erro no meu cliente owncloud ...

    
por user1073075 29.01.2015 / 22:43

2 respostas

-1

Crie seu certificado SSL novamente, não se esqueça de preencher o Nome comum ou o FQDN. No meu caso foi igual a comentar mais alto. Eu coloquei o endereço IP e isso funciona.

  1. crie um novo script ssl - validação, por ex. 365 dias

    sudo openssl req -x509 -nodes -days 365 -newkey rsa:2048 -keyout /etc/apache2/ssl/apache.key -out /etc/apache2/ssl/apache.crt
    
  2. preenche todos os campos - aqui está o campo COMMONNAME - FQDN ou IP

  3. reinicie o apache

    sudo service apache2 restart
    
por 17.03.2015 / 22:13
0

Eu consertei alterando o atributo commonname para o endereço IP que utilizo para acessar meu servidor owncloud.

Acho que a mensagem de erro é um pouco enganadora, talvez o atributo não estivesse correto, mas certamente não estava "ausente" ...

    
por 30.01.2015 / 16:31